Re: mbox 3 pro vs digi 003
I can not speak from the experience of owning one (regarding malfunctions, etc.), but I can speak from having heard them sound quality wise, and it's not even a contest. The Mbox Pro conversion is on a whole different level (better).
However, none of that helps if the thing doesn't work. It does seem there's been some quality control issues, but I don't know if some of the negativity has been from operator error. The Mbox Pro can be a little more complex to set up in that it uses separate software for setting up and routing, similar to many 3rd party interfaces (Focusrite Mix Control, Apogee Maestro, etc.). Also, as you may know, they are very different in terms of the amount of inputs/outputs. There are also many nice 3rd party solutions, if you're on PT9 or later. Re: mbox 3 pro vs digi 003
You skipped an important question; how many inputs do you need at any one time??? If its 4, then the Mbox would likely serve you well enough. But if you ever want to track a band or a full drum kit, then the 003 is a much wiser choice. The basic 003 starts off with 4 mic preamps that are adequate(plain vanilla), but offers several ways to add more preamps, AND better converters. On my rig, I use the 003 controller and have the setup maxed out to the full 18 inputs with the following:
Focusrite Octopre Mk II Dynamic(analog out to the 003 line inputs) Focusrite ISA-428 w/digital card(lightpipe into the 003) Vintech and API preamps(feeding the A>D car in the 428) DBX-386 2 channel tube preamp(feeding the SPDIF input of the 003). The Mbox Pro tops out at 8 total inputs, but 2 of those 8 are on -10(consumer level) RCA inputs, so its "sort of" 8 inputs(4 mic preamps, 2 channels via SPDIF and 2 channels via the RCA jacks).

Re: mbox 3 pro vs digi 003
Don't get me wrong here. I agree that the new 3rd gen Mboxes have better converters than the 003(and better preamps as well, which I am bypassing to a certain degree). My ISA, DBX and lunchbox preamps all bypass those converters for all my "important" channels. The stock converters are only handling snare and toms(where they sound fine), scratch guitars and talkback mics. As long as the Mbox Pro has your IO needs covered, I would go with that. Only reason I chimed in was because I have seen new users buy Mboxes and then whine about not being able to record a drum kit
